Nonprofits often know they need to “listen to their community,” but putting that into practice (especially at scale) can be challenging. In this episode, we talk with Bill Villafranco, Executive Director and former Board Chair at myFace, about his path from finance to nonprofit leadership and how community feedback is shaping programs like interdisciplinary hospital care and inclusive media projects. It’s a conversation for anyone thinking about how to grow a mission-driven organization without losing sight of the people it serves.
About the guest
Bill Villafranco is a storyteller and philanthropic leader whose personal journey through grief, addiction, and mental health informs his work in healing communities. He serves as Executive Director of MyFace.org and trustee of the Virginia B. Toulmin Foundation, where he champions trauma-informed, emotionally intelligent funding strategies. With a focus on long-term impact, Bill brings a deeply human approach to both mental wellness advocacy and nonprofit leadership.
